FSGHFStock

Field Solutions Holdings Limited, a telecommunications carrier and technology company, provides connectivity and business solutions for rural, regional, and remote areas in Australia. It offers cloud computing, cloud application development, and cloud software development services. The company provides various end-to-end solutions from concept and strategy, to design, implementation, and support; and designs and builds custom software systems; establishes private and public cloud hosting services. It also designs and deploys private networks; migrates existing products and software to the cloud; manages, monitors, and optimizes cloud and network infrastructure; and builds disaster recovery scenarios. In addition, the company offers business and enterprise, government, and residential solutions, such as internet access, private network, enterprise voice solutions, and managed services; and regional access network, including fiber and fixed wireless spectrum to broadband solutions. Field Solutions Holdings Limited was incorporated in 2004 and is based in Belrose, Australia.

PGConsumer Staples

The Procter & Gamble Company provides branded consumer packaged goods worldwide. It operates through five segments: Beauty; Grooming; Health Care; Fabric & Home Care; and Baby, Feminine & Family Care. The Beauty segment offers conditioners, shampoos, styling aids, and treatments under the Head & Shoulders, Herbal Essences, Pantene, and Rejoice brands; and antiperspirants and deodorants, personal cleansing, and skin care products under the Olay, Old Spice, Safeguard, Secret, and SK-II brands. The Grooming segment provides shave care products and appliances under the Braun, Gillette, and Venus brand names. The Health Care segment offers toothbrushes, toothpastes, and other oral care products under the Crest and Oral-B brand names; and gastrointestinal, rapid diagnostics, respiratory, vitamins/minerals/supplements, pain relief, and other personal health care products under the Metamucil, Neurobion, Pepto-Bismol, and Vicks brands. The Fabric & Home Care segment provides fabric enhancers, laundry additives, and laundry detergents under the Ariel, Downy, Gain, and Tide brands; and air care, dish care, P&G professional, and surface care products under the Cascade, Dawn, Fairy, Febreze, Mr. Clean, and Swiffer brands. The Baby, Feminine & Family Care segment offers baby wipes, taped diapers, and pants under the Luvs and Pampers brands; adult incontinence and feminine care products under the Always, Always Discreet, and Tampax brands; and paper towels, tissues, and toilet papers under the Bounty, Charmin, and Puffs brands. The company sells its products primarily through mass merchandisers, e-commerce, grocery stores, membership club stores, drug stores, department stores, distributors, wholesalers, specialty beauty stores, high-frequency stores, pharmacies, electronics stores, and professional channels, as well as directly to consumers. The Procter & Gamble Company was founded in 1837 and is headquartered in Cincinnati, Ohio.
